Output 895b107da4fe306b8d3aa05e11e75545a1be24e033068c0363bc11c6a5b62f36:0

value
1507476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e615e58012f84463260edfeee674bf4a11b26d OP_EQUAL
address
M8oVwnBPyRrp9GA9mY1RZ28taXpJ9Sib64
transaction
895b107da4fe306b8d3aa05e11e75545a1be24e033068c0363bc11c6a5b62f36
spent
true